Guatemalan Mother's Asylum Petition Denied by Court of Appeals
Brenda Beatriz Organiz-Perez De Lorenzo, a Guatemalan woman and her two minor children, petitioned for review after being denied asylum, withholding of removal, and protection under the Convention Against Torture. She fled Guatemala in February 2019 after receiving threatening phone calls demanding money. The Seventh Circuit Court of Appeals denied her petition, finding she failed to establish eligibility for relief on multiple grounds including lack of nexus between the threats and her claimed protected social group.
